Job Description
The Receptionist/Clinic Supervisor is responsible for oversight of all front office and back office duties. The position supervises the front office staff and back office staff (Receptionist, Referral Coordinator, Insurance Specialist, Medical Assistants). The clinic Supervisor ensures Front Office Representatives and Clinical team work as a team to assure optimal patient flow. The Supervisor represents the company professionally and positively to enhance and promote the core values and mission of the organization, always exercising utmost discretion, diplomacy and tact in patient/staff interactions. The supervisor provides assistance to all providers and staff and reports directly to the Practice Manager.
K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ES:Provide supervision to entire staff.
Provide and promote excellent customer service to visitors, patients, and staff in person and on the phone.
Responsible for clinic flow, front office to back office
Supports the organization as needed
QUALIFICATIONS/EXPERIENCE/REQUIREMENTS:Bachelor’s degree and a minimum of five years of supervisory experience in customer service, patient registration, health information, and other medical office experience is required.
Must have experience in handling or collecting cash payments.
Bilingual in Spanish is preferred.
Must pass a substance abuse testing upon employment, and submit to a random testing during the course of employment.
K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ES:Expert knowledge in health information practices, concepts, and legal requirements.
Able to multitask in a fast paced demanding area while remaining calm & collected.
Understanding of the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A) and an ability to maintain strictest confidentiality of patients’ information.
Knowledge of general office procedures including, answering phones, directing calls, photocopying, faxing, typing, etc.
Possess a positive attitude.
Skills in supervising personnel.
Skills in utilizing an Electronic Health Records (EHR). As super user, supports training and operability needs of staff.
Advanced computer skills including knowledge of software applications such as MS Word (EXCEL, PowerPoint and Outlook).
Ability to work under minimal supervision while meeting all requirements of the position; Ability to make decisions independently.
Ability to work with people and to make them comfortable in regards to the release of personal, financial, and medical information.
Ability to work simultaneously with multiple levels of supervision and differing program requirements.
Ability to communicate and engage others in order to carry out assignments, meet goals and ensure the success of Kidsville Pediatrics.
Ability to confirm private insurance benefits and determine associated co-pay requirements.
Ability to receive and account for cash and check payments.
